APL handles multi-technical maintenance for two computer rooms and tertiary buildings belonging to Universal Music
Customer name : | Universal Music |
Area of business : | Music label |
Completion date : | Since 2007 |
Accompanying mode : | Turnkey |
Type of service : | Multi-technical maintenance |
In order to ensure uninterrupted continuity of service for its recording studios, Universal Music chose to retain APL to handle the maintenance of its computer rooms, which are hosted in the same facilities as its head office in Paris.
Project objective
- Since 2007, APL has performed all maintenance operations on the music label’s IT and tertiary facilities, for all work packages: electricity, air conditioning, security, fire protection, safety, and VDI wiring.
Services provided
- Preventive maintenance for all work packages: site visits; monitoring of temperatures in the computer rooms; inspection of cabling, security systems, fire protection systems, etc.
- 24/7 corrective maintenance for all work packages, with an on-site response commitment of 4 hours
- Operation and technical upgrades of service equipment
- Determination of actions needed in order to improve the site and its reliability
Client benefits
- A single contact company for all work packages
- Planning and coordination of all maintenance operations
- Industrialization of procedures for operation and maintenance
- The expertise and stringent standards needed to maintain and operate computer rooms hosted in tertiary facilities
